About Liege
Liege is a city where history and culture can be felt on every street corner. From the cobbled streets of the historic center to the lively quays, the city tells the story of centuries of trade and industry while hosting a vibrant artistic life.
Liege has been shaped by its industrial and commercial past, yet it has always nurtured its cultural identity. Traditional markets, such as La Batte, one of Belgium’s oldest and busiest markets, have been gathering locals for generations. The city is also renowned for its festivals, including the Liège International Film Festival and numerous music events throughout the year, ranging from classical music to rock and jazz.
Visitors discover a living heritage: historic churches, cafés, small bookstores, and artisan workshops all bear witness to a cultural legacy that remains alive. Liege waffles, artisanal chocolates, and local beer invite visitors to taste the city’s traditions. And behind each street lies a story: secret passages once used by Meuse traders, murals depicting the city’s history, or local legends passed down through generations.
